The product is a herbal tea made from knotgrass, a plant with a long history in traditional herbal practice. Its key components include tannins, which give the herb its mildly astringent character; flavonoids, which are valued in herbalism for their antioxidant role; and silicic acid (silica), which makes the plant notable among classic wild herbs. These constituents work together to create an infusion that is both mineral-rich and gently astringent. Tannins interact with proteins on mucous surfaces, creating a tightening effect, while flavonoids support cellular protection. Silica contributes to the herb's mineral profile, distinguishing it among wild herbs traditionally used in Baltic and Eastern European preparations. People typically choose this type of herb when they want a simple plant infusion as part of a course based on classic botanical use, especially when a mildly astringent, mineral-rich herb is preferred.
